VENTURE RICHMOND TO DISPLAY GIANT HOLIDAY CARDS DOWNTOWN
The James Center (10
th & E. Cary)
Holiday Greetings! The 4
th annual exhibition of art cards will be on display downtown during the month of December. The giant cards, each created from wooden doors, are designed and painted by art classes and clubs in schools from the City of Richmond, Henrico County, Chesterfield County and private schools. TH ANNUAL COURT END CHRISTMAS
Join the Valentine Richmond History Center, John Marshall House, Museum and White House of the Confederacy, St. John's Church and
Historic Richmond Foundation's Monumental Church for this FREE family day from 12-5pm. Fun for all ages! Horse-drawn carriage rides,
cookie decorating, children's activities, costumed historians, holiday card making, music, games and more. Clay Street between 10
th &
11
th Streets will be closed to cars. Free parking at the MCV Deck; trolleys will be available for travel to and from all sites. For more information call 804-649-0711.
